2/9/14 Hunt A Good Day with Mark and the Dogs

We booked this hunt mid week and the forcast looked a bit rough, but each day I checked the weather it got a little better.  It ended up being about 20 out with light wind and sun.  The only issue was the deep snow, some drifts being mid thigh deep.  Well we got out and had a great hunt.  We released 8 pheasants and ended up taking 7, missed one, but we picked up a scratch chucker, it was Mark's first chucker.  I had the go pro out again and am hoping to have the video tomorrow some time.  The only part of the hunt that frustrated me was when two birds spooked up ahead of us before the dogs could point them and I shot both of them.  The irratating part was I didn't have time to hit record on the gopro, so I missed the filming of my first double.  Also, Willow hit some fence and started limping a bit, so we put her back in the car and Autumn got her first go at a solo hunt for the last hour.  She pointed the chucker and retrieved it after Mark hit it.  I am looking forward to seeing what kind of footage I got of that.  Watch for the video tomorrow.
